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a residential sewage tank should be professionally inspected at least every 3-5 years by skilled professionals. Throughout this process, the expert inspectors will examine for seepage, check both the upper and lower sections of your tank, analyze the accumulated scum and sludge in your tank, and perform skilled maintenance of your t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
The lower the amount of water in a residence results in less water going into the sewage system. Toilet usage accounts for approximately 25% to 30% of water consumption in the household. An optimal method to reduce water usage in the toilet involves replacing current models with high-efficiency fixtures, which use fewer gallons of water for each fl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ized during bathing is also directed into the sewage system. To decrease this, the smart choice involves using high-efficiency shower appliances, specifically designed to decrease water consumption.

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
As crucial as looking after the sewage system each year, it is equally vital to administer seasonal maintenance to the sewage tank system. Below are several tips for seasonal maintenance across the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Taking proper care of the sewage system plays a significant role in anticipating for severe winter weather.
- Consider pumping the sewage tank during the fall, as it's challenging when winter sets in.
- In the fall, limit the use of lawn mowers within the vicinity of the sewage tank, and avoid using automobiles in this area at all costs.
- Moreover, make sure to shield the treatment soil from freezing.
Winter
Taking care of septic systems during the winter might be substantial hurdles, given the freezing temperatures. That's why, it's wise to start preparing for cold weather ahead of time, typically in autumn.
The crucial care you can offer your sewage system during winter involves regularly inspecting the four common areas where septic systems might freeze, aiming to prevent this problem. These locations are:
- The pipeline leading from the house's tank
- The tube that goes to the area designated for soil treatment
- The designated soil treatment zone
- In addition to the waste tank

FAQs
QUESTION: What's the ideal pumping schedule for my septic tank?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, but usually, septic tanks should be pumped about every every three to five years.
